Class HTTPRouteMatchBuilder
- java.lang.Object
-
- io.fabric8.kubernetes.api.builder.BaseFluent<A>
-
- io.fabric8.kubernetes.api.model.gatewayapi.v1.HTTPRouteMatchFluent<HTTPRouteMatchBuilder>
-
- io.fabric8.kubernetes.api.model.gatewayapi.v1.HTTPRouteMatchBuilder
-
- All Implemented Interfaces:
io.fabric8.kubernetes.api.builder.Builder<HTTPRouteMatch>
,io.fabric8.kubernetes.api.builder.Visitable<HTTPRouteMatchBuilder>
,io.fabric8.kubernetes.api.builder.VisitableBuilder<HTTPRouteMatch,HTTPRouteMatchBuilder>
public class HTTPRouteMatchBuilder extends HTTPRouteMatchFluent<HTTPRouteMatchBuilder> implements io.fabric8.kubernetes.api.builder.VisitableBuilder<HTTPRouteMatch,HTTPRouteMatchBuilder>
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class io.fabric8.kubernetes.api.model.gatewayapi.v1.HTTPRouteMatchFluent
HTTPRouteMatchFluent.HeadersNested<N>, HTTPRouteMatchFluent.PathNested<N>, HTTPRouteMatchFluent.QueryParamsNested<N>
-
-
Constructor Summary
Constructors Constructor Description HTTPRouteMatchBuilder()
HTTPRouteMatchBuilder(HTTPRouteMatch instance)
HTTPRouteMatchBuilder(HTTPRouteMatchFluent<?> fluent)
HTTPRouteMatchBuilder(HTTPRouteMatchFluent<?> fluent, HTTPRouteMatch instance)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description HTTPRouteMatch
build()
-
Methods inherited from class io.fabric8.kubernetes.api.model.gatewayapi.v1.HTTPRouteMatchFluent
addAllToHeaders, addAllToQueryParams, addNewHeader, addNewHeader, addNewHeaderLike, addNewQueryParam, addNewQueryParam, addNewQueryParamLike, addToAdditionalProperties, addToAdditionalProperties, addToHeaders, addToHeaders, addToQueryParams, addToQueryParams, buildFirstHeader, buildFirstQueryParam, buildHeader, buildHeaders, buildLastHeader, buildLastQueryParam, buildMatchingHeader, buildMatchingQueryParam, buildPath, buildQueryParam, buildQueryParams, copyInstance, editFirstHeader, editFirstQueryParam, editHeader, editLastHeader, editLastQueryParam, editMatchingHeader, editMatchingQueryParam, editOrNewPath, editOrNewPathLike, editPath, editQueryParam, equals, getAdditionalProperties, getMethod, hasAdditionalProperties, hashCode, hasHeaders, hasMatchingHeader, hasMatchingQueryParam, hasMethod, hasPath, hasQueryParams, removeAllFromHeaders, removeAllFromQueryParams, removeFromAdditionalProperties, removeFromAdditionalProperties, removeFromHeaders, removeFromQueryParams, removeMatchingFromHeaders, removeMatchingFromQueryParams, setNewHeaderLike, setNewQueryParamLike, setToHeaders, setToQueryParams, toString, withAdditionalProperties, withHeaders, withHeaders, withMethod, withNewPath, withNewPath, withNewPathLike, withPath, withQueryParams, withQueryParams
-
Methods inherited from class io.fabric8.kubernetes.api.builder.BaseFluent
aggregate, aggregate, build, build, builderOf, getVisitableMap
-
-
-
-
Constructor Detail
-
HTTPRouteMatchBuilder
public HTTPRouteMatchBuilder()
-
HTTPRouteMatchBuilder
public HTTPRouteMatchBuilder(HTTPRouteMatchFluent<?> fluent)
-
HTTPRouteMatchBuilder
public HTTPRouteMatchBuilder(HTTPRouteMatchFluent<?> fluent, HTTPRouteMatch instance)
-
HTTPRouteMatchBuilder
public HTTPRouteMatchBuilder(HTTPRouteMatch instance)
-
-
Method Detail
-
build
public HTTPRouteMatch build()
- Specified by:
build
in interfaceio.fabric8.kubernetes.api.builder.Builder<HTTPRouteMatch>
-
-